The Grass Is Always Greener, Tips For A Successful Lawn
Some of the greenest grass is achieved only by meticulous grooming and care. One of the best ways to ensure a beautiful and lush green lawn is to install an irrigation system that will regularly water the grass and keep it hydrated and healthily growing. Regular watering of the lawn can be easily forgotten and watering the grass with a hose can be uneven. Installing an irrigation system ensures that the lawn will be watered evenly and that it will be watered regularly on a set schedule.
